Backup e restauração do Linux com Timeshift

Ao trabalhar no suporte ou como usuários frequentes de um sistema operacional, é extremamente importante ter sempre a disponibilidade e integridade de toda a estrutura do sistema, pois cada usuário lida com aplicativos, ambientes e parâmetros de forma diferente.

Para ter sempre esta configuração temos as cópias de segurança do sistema que armazenam tudo o que configuramos no sistema e, em caso de erros, podemos restaurar essa configuração ao seu estado original facilmente e sem a necessidade de configurar tudo manualmente. Novo o que implica perda de tempo.

Uma das melhores ferramentas para isso é Mudança de horário E hoje este tutorial vai analisar como instalá-lo e fazer uso dele no Ubuntu 17.

O que é TimeshiftTimeshift é uma aplicação open source que cumpre a tarefa de restaurar o sistema em ambientes Windows ou Time Machine em ambientes macOS, permitindo-nos ter snapshots do sistema, permitindo-nos sempre ter a sua disponibilidade.

O Timeshift tira instantâneos incrementais do sistema operacional e dos arquivos armazenados nele, e esses instantâneos podem ser restaurados a qualquer momento para desfazer as alterações no sistema.

Timeshift faz uso dos comandos rsync e hard-links para tirar instantâneos e arquivos comuns são compartilhados entre os instantâneos, o que nos permite economizar espaço no disco rígido e cada instantâneo pode ser consultado com o gerenciador de arquivos.

É importante esclarecer que os arquivos do usuário, como documentos, fotos e música, são excluídos do instantâneo para economizar espaço no instantâneo.

Recursos de timeshiftAo usar o Timeshift, temos as seguintes características:

  • Gratuito e de código aberto.
  • Criação de instantâneos de inicialização que permitem um nível adicional de backup.
  • Opções abrangentes de agendamento de instantâneos.
  • Configuração mínima do aplicativo.
  • Todos os instantâneos serão salvos no diretório / timeshift.
  • Melhores opções de instantâneo.
  • Capacidade de excluir arquivos de instantâneos.
  • É possível restaurar os backups em distros diferentes.

1. Instale o Timeshift no Ubuntu 17

Passo 1
Para instalar o Timeshift no Ubuntu 17 será necessário executar os seguintes comandos:

 sudo apt-add-repository -y ppa: teejee2008 / ppa (Adicionar repositório) sudo apt update (Atualizar pacotes) sudo apt installed timeshift (Instalar Timeshift)

Passo 2
No caso de termos outras distros Linux teremos que procurar seus respectivos downloads, por exemplo, para Archlinux teremos o seguinte link de download em Timeshift:

etapa 3
Para a instalação dessas duas arquiteturas executaremos as seguintes linhas como root:

  • No caso da edição de 32 bits:
 chmod + x timeshift-latest-i386.run (Atribuição de permissão) sh ./timeshift-latest-i386.run (execução de arquivo)
  • No caso da edição de 64 bits:
 chmod + x timeshift-latest-amd64.run (Atribuição de permissão) sh ./timeshift-latest-amd64.run (execução de arquivo)

2. Execute Timeshift no Ubuntu 17

Passo 1
Para acessar o Timeshift podemos executar a palavra diretamente no terminal Mudança de horário ou use o mecanismo de pesquisa de equipe:

Passo 2
Ao acessar o Timeshift pela primeira vez, o assistente a seguir será exibido, onde configuraremos os seguintes valores como Tipo de instantâneo a ser obtido. Lá podemos selecionar entre os instantâneos em Rsync ou em BTRFS, conforme o caso e os requisitos atuais. Podemos ver uma descrição do que cada opção nos oferece.

etapa 3
Clique em Avançar e agora selecionaremos o caminho onde o instantâneo será armazenado:

Passo 4
Uma vez selecionado, clique em Avançar novamente e agora definiremos a frequência com que os instantâneos serão criados e temos as seguintes opções:

  • Diário
  • Por mês
  • Semanalmente
  • No início

Etapa 5
Lá podemos definir a respectiva frequência. Clique em Avançar e na próxima janela veremos que tudo está completo:

Etapa 6
Clique em Terminar Para fechar o assistente de configuração e acessar o ambiente do aplicativo Timeshift:

PROLONGAR

Etapa 7
Como podemos ver, temos as seguintes opções:

CrioIsso nos permite criar um instantâneo manualmente.

RestaurarVamos restaurar um instantâneo atual.

ExcluirPermite a exclusão de instantâneos armazenados no sistema.

NavegarEle nos permite navegar para outros instantâneos em rotas diferentes.

ConfiguraçõesPodemos abrir o assistente de configuração novamente.

bruxoAbra o assistente de aplicativo para obter ajuda.

Na parte inferior, veremos o estado atual do Timeshift, o número de instantâneos tirados do sistema e o espaço disponível.

Etapa 8
Para criar um novo instantâneo do Ubuntu, clique no botão Crio e ele iniciará o processo automaticamente:

Etapa 9
Assim que o processo for concluído, veremos o backup criado corretamente com suas informações:

PROLONGAR

3. Restaure o sistema com Timeshift no Ubuntu 17

Passo 1
Para restaurar o sistema, simplesmente selecione o instantâneo a ser usado e pressione o botão. Restaurar e o seguinte assistente será exibido:

Passo 2
Lá podemos ver a estrutura onde os elementos serão restaurados. Clique em Avançar e agora podemos definir quais tipos de elementos serão excluídos da restauração:

etapa 3
Na próxima janela veremos o diretório onde os dados serão modificados:

Passo 4
Continuando Próximo o sistema será reiniciado automaticamente para aplicar as alterações feitas pelo Timeshift. Assim que o sistema for reiniciado iremos acessar normalmente.

PROLONGAR

Como podemos ver, o Timeshift é uma solução simples e funcional para realizar todo o processo de backup e restauração em ambientes Linux.

wave wave wave wave wave